The Persian word حزب (pronounced 'Hezb') is a fundamental noun in the Persian language, specifically within the domains of political science, sociology, and news media. At its core, it refers to a political party—an organized group of people who share a common political ideology or goal and work together to influence government policy or win elections. However, its usage in Persian is more restrictive than the English word 'party.' While in English you might use 'party' for a birthday celebration, a legal group, or a political entity, in Persian, حزب is almost exclusively reserved for the political context. Using it to describe a social gathering is a common mistake for English speakers; for social events, Persians use the word مهمانی (mehmāni).
- Political Context
- The term describes formal organizations recognized by the state that field candidates and advocate for specific legislation. It is a loanword from Arabic, where it originally meant a 'faction' or 'group of like-minded individuals.'

In the context of Iranian history and modern politics, حزب carries significant weight. From the early 20th-century Constitutional Revolution to the contemporary era, parties have been the vehicle for ideological struggle. You will encounter this word daily if you listen to Persian news (like BBC Persian, Iran International, or VOA Persian). It is often paired with descriptors like 'ruling' (حاکم), 'opposition' (مخالف), or 'reformist' (اصلاحطلب).
- Etymological Nuance
- The root H-Z-B in Arabic implies a sense of toughness or grouping against an adversary. In the Quran, the 'Ahzab' (plural) refers to the confederates who besieged Medina. Thus, the word conveys a sense of strong internal solidarity.
Furthermore, the word is used in religious contexts, such as a 'Hezb' of the Quran, which refers to one-sixtieth of the holy book. However, for a B1 learner, the political definition is the primary focus. Understanding the plural form, احزاب (Ahzāb), is also crucial, as Persian often uses broken Arabic plurals for formal terminology.

- Register and Tone
- The word is formal and neutral. It can be used in academic papers, news reports, and respectful dinner table conversations about world events. It does not carry an inherently negative or positive connotation; that depends on the adjectives attached to it.
Using حزب correctly requires an understanding of Persian syntax and common collocations. Since it is a noun, it often acts as the subject or object of a sentence. Because it refers to an organization, it is frequently used with verbs like 'joining' (عضو شدن), 'forming' (تشکیل دادن), or 'supporting' (حمایت کردن).

When describing someone's affiliation, you use the Ezafe construction: عضوِ حزب (ozv-e hezb). For example, 'member of the Labour Party' would be عضو حزب کارگر. Note how the noun phrase builds logically from the general to the specific.
- Grammatical Pattern: Membership
- [Name] + عضو (member) + [Party Name] + است (is). Example: 'علی عضو حزب سبز است' (Ali is a member of the Green Party).
In more complex sentences, حزب can be the head of a relative clause. For instance, 'The party that I support' becomes حزبی که من از آن حمایت میکنم. Notice the use of the 'i' of definition (ی اشارت) attached to 'hezb' to make it 'hezbi ke'.

Another common usage is as an adjective: حزبی (hezbi), meaning 'partisan' or 'party-related'. For example, منافع حزبی (partisan interests). This is vital for understanding political commentary where the speaker might criticize someone for putting 'party interests' above 'national interests' (منافع ملی).
- Common Verb Pairings
- 1. انحلال حزب (Dissolution of a party)
2. تاسیس حزب (Founding a party)
3. دبیرکل حزب (Secretary-general of the party)

If you are an English speaker learning Persian, you will encounter حزب in several specific environments. The most frequent is broadcast news. Whether it is a report on the US elections (discussing حزب دموکرات and حزب جمهوریخواه) or news from the Iranian parliament (Majlis), the word is ubiquitous. It acts as the primary descriptor for political identity.

Another common place is history books and documentaries. Iran's 20th-century history is defined by groups like the حزب توده (Tudeh Party) or the حزب رستاخیز (Rastakhiz Party). Understanding these references is key to cultural literacy in Persian. In these contexts, 'Hezb' isn't just a vocabulary word; it's a marker of historical eras.
- Social Media & Debates
- On platforms like X (Twitter) or in Clubhouse rooms, Iranians often debate 'hezb-garāyi' (partisanship). You will hear people argue whether Iran needs a 'nezām-e hezbi' (party-based system) to progress.
You will also hear it in academic lectures. Professors of political science or sociology use 'Hezb' to discuss the 'mobilization of the masses' (بسیج تودهها). In this register, the word is used with high-frequency academic verbs like نهادینه کردن (to institutionalize). If you are listening to a podcast about the history of the Middle East, 'Hezb' will be a recurring anchor word.

- The 'Hezbollah' Connection
- One of the most internationally recognized uses is in 'Hezbollah' (حزبالله), meaning 'Party of God.' This term appears in the Quran and has been adopted by various groups, most notably in Lebanon. Understanding the literal meaning helps demystify the name.
The most glaring mistake English speakers make with حزب is the semantic overlap with the English word 'party.' In English, 'party' is a polysemous word—it has many meanings. You go to a party, you are a party to a contract, and you belong to a political party. In Persian, these are three different words. Using 'Hezb' for a birthday party is not just a minor error; it changes the meaning to something absurdly political.
- Mistake #1: Social Events
- Incorrect: 'Man be hezb-e tavallod miravam' (I am going to a political party of birth).
Correct: 'Man be mehmāni-ye tavallod miravam' (I am going to a birthday party).
Another common mistake involves pluralization. While 'Hezb-hā' is technically correct and used in casual conversation, learners often fail to recognize 'Ahzāb' in formal texts. 'Ahzāb' is an Arabic 'broken plural' (jam' taksir). Failing to recognize this can make news articles seem incomprehensible. Learners should memorize both forms to ensure they can navigate both registers of the language.

A subtle mistake is the misplacement of the Ezafe when naming parties. For example, to say 'The Republican Party,' you must say 'Hezb-e Jomhuri-khāh.' Learners often forget the 'e' sound (the Ezafe) that links the word 'party' to its name. Without the Ezafe, the two words sit next to each other without a grammatical connection, which sounds disjointed to a native speaker.
- Mistake #2: The 'Hezbi' Adjective
- Learners often use the noun 'Hezb' when they should use the adjective 'Hezbi'. If you want to say 'partisan behavior,' you must say 'raftār-e hezbi,' not 'raftār-e hezb.'
Finally, be careful with the word جناح (janāh). While 'Janāh' means 'wing' (like left-wing or right-wing), it is sometimes used interchangeably with 'Hezb' in casual talk. However, a 'Janāh' is usually a broader faction that might contain multiple 'Ahzāb'. Confusing the two can lead to a lack of precision in political discussions.
To truly master حزب, you must understand the words that surround it in the semantic field of 'organizations' and 'groups.' Depending on the level of formality and the specific nature of the group, you might choose a different term.
- 1. تشکل (Tashakkol)
- Meaning: Organization or association. This is often used for labor unions or student organizations (تشکلهای دانشجویی). It is less strictly 'political' than 'Hezb' and implies a structured formation.
- 2. جبهه (Jebhe)
- Meaning: Front. In politics, a 'Jebhe' is an alliance of several parties or groups working toward a common goal, like the 'National Front' (جبهه ملی). It is broader than a single 'Hezb'.
- 3. جمعیت (Jam'iyat)
- Meaning: Society or association. While it can mean 'population,' in a political context, it refers to a group or society, like the 'Red Crescent Society' (جمعیت هلال احمر).

When discussing a smaller, perhaps less formal group, you might use گروه (goruh) or دسته (dasteh). گروه is the most versatile word for 'group' and can be used for anything from a group of friends to a music band. دسته often carries a slightly more informal or even derogatory tone when used in politics, similar to 'clique' or 'gang' in certain contexts.
- 4. سازمان (Sāzmān)
- Meaning: Organization. This is a very broad term used for government bodies (like the UN - سازمان ملل) or large NGOs. It is more bureaucratic than 'Hezb'.
In summary, while 'Hezb' is your go-to word for political entities, being aware of 'Jebhe' and 'Tashakkol' will allow you to describe the nuances of political and social organization in Persian-speaking societies much more accurately.
